About WESTWOOD HOLDINGS GROUP INC
Westwood Holdings Group, Inc., through its subsidiaries, manages investment assets and provides services for its clients. The company operates in two segments, Advisory and Trust. The Advisory segment provides investment advisory services to corporate retirement plans, public retirement plans, endowments, foundations, individuals, and the Westwood Funds; and investment sub-advisory services to mutual funds, pooled investment vehicles, and its Trust segment. The Trust segment offers trust and custodial services; and participates in common trust funds that it sponsors to institutions and high net worth individuals. Westwood Holdings Group, Inc. was founded in 1983 and is based in Dallas, Texas.

Is WHG financially healthy?
WESTWOOD HOLDINGS GROUP INC's Piotroski F-score is 5/9 (8–9 is excellent, 0–3 weak).
Does WHG pay a dividend, and is it safe?
Yes. WESTWOOD HOLDINGS GROUP INC pays a dividend yielding about 3.12% with a 75.8% payout ratio, rated “stretched” for safety.
How profitable is WHG?
In FY2025, WESTWOOD HOLDINGS GROUP INC had a net margin of 7.2% and a return on equity of 5.6%.
Is WHG overvalued or undervalued?
WESTWOOD HOLDINGS GROUP INC trades at about 24.3× trailing earnings — above its 10-year norm (10-year range 10.5×–59.2×, median 20.2×). Stocktoria reports the data, not buy/sell advice.
